Canaan United Methodist Church Men's Ministry sponsored its first Father-son and daughter fishing tournament at High Rock Lake on Sunday, May 4, 2003. { 2004 event May 23rd } The day's activities started off with the men cooking breakfast for their children and grandchildren during the monthly breakfast meeting. Newcomers to the area were also invited to participate in the fellowship, worship service and fishing tournament.
Over twenty anglers arrived with their minnows, worms, and fishing gear at Pepple Beach to pursue their place in history as prizes were available in three categories. After a brief organizational gathering to review the tournament rules and safety issues, the boat captains left the docks of Max and Darcus Bisher promptly at 2 pm. Joe Foley was the official weigh master when the fleet of boats returned at 5 pm. The largest fish (1.6 lbs.) was caught by  young angler Baret Bledsoe; the smallest one was pulled from the water by Caleb Ward; and the largest amount of fish (over 6 lbs.) was caught by our church minister Dan Money and parishioners Caleb Ward and David Lanier ll.  Addie Grubb caught  several large fish that were floating on the water surface. Unfortunately, they did not qualify at the weigh-in.  Church photographer  was very busy capturing the anglers, their catch, and the weigh-in-activities. Many church members who did not fish in the tournament arrived at five pm to check out the fish that were caught and listen to the story of the "big one that got away".
